fink- 0.28.1 was released on 3/11.  And 0.28.0 was released on 1/20 .

If we're talking about changes in the package manager, it might be  
worth trying to build the package with fink-0.27.11 instead, and also  
to try using Tiger (I can do neither right now since I'm in the middle  
of a buildfink job involving everything that was in the tracker as of  
yesterday evening).  If the latter fails and the former succeeds, that  
would tend to put suspicion on fink, whereas if it works on Tiger but  
not Leopard, the OS seems to be more culpable.

If we're talking changes in the Fink distribution, that's harder to  
understand, since none of the dependencies have been updated since  
before 2/11 .
